    From my experience if you try to flash higher than 1.1v you end up w/ 1.05v instead of 1.1v, so set it to 1.1v or you won't get any improvement.

    Don't mess w/ anything in the VID Mode tab. That won't do anything for you, and you might make it to where the 1.1v mod won't work. Just go the the Exact Mode tab and change Extra to 1.1v. It will either be blank or say 1.05v before you change it.

    It seems some cards come from the factory w/ 1.1v, so those folks might not get any better results after the mod, but they usually get high clocks anyway.
